    Seems the page linked here may have been last updated in only 2014 but the original author did respond to me so I’ll include his comments in this post for context:

    I’m the ex-webmaster, and I’ll leave the current webmaster, Liam, to reply on behalf of APF. (I’m still on the Tech Committee with him).

    I created that page back in about 2000, as one of a set of 4 resources. I moved it onto the APF site (where I’ve been active for many years), but received no support, little interest, and fewer hits than I do on my own web-site.

    So I moved three of them (Aust national, Aust subsidiary jurisdictions, and international instruments) back to my site c. 2015, e.g. here: http://www.rogerclarke.com/DV/PLawsClth.html

    Even those three need some updating - it’s been very busy lately (for me personally too, but I actually meant for developments in privacy law).

    I don’t think any of the four have been touched on the APF site since my last updates, maybe about 2014? (WordPress fails to carry decent meta-data, so I can’t tell).

    There’s a link on WorldLII, here: http://www.worldlii.org/catalog/2972.html

    But Privacy International are as bad as so many other sites and fail to provide permanent URLs, and http://www.ictparliament.org/node/2089 has disappeared as well.

    If you send a URL for the ZA law, or for a site that indexes ZA privacy laws, we’ll see if we can get it updated.
